Some Dodgeville School District students will be heading back to the classroom soon. On Thursday, the school board voted to allow younger students to return to class as well as some older students who meet certain criteria. Following the vote, District Administrator Paul Weber sent a note to students’ families informing them about the changes. Weber told families that each principal will be sending out details Friday explaining how the return to the classroom will work. He added that the new procedures are expected to remain in place until the holiday break, unless an outbreak among students or staff occurs. The board is set to reconvene prior to the end of the year to decide on a plan for 2021. Dodgeville had been utilizing virtual learning since the end of October.
